Detalles del Curso
โข Advanced IoT Architecture for Energy Flow Optimization: This unit will cover the latest IoT architectures and their implementation for energy flow optimization. It will include topics like edge computing, fog computing, and cloud-based systems. โข IoT Sensors and Energy Flow Monitoring: This unit will focus on the various IoT sensors used for energy flow monitoring and their integration into energy management systems. โข Data Analytics and Energy Flow Optimization: This unit will cover data analytics techniques for energy flow optimization, including machine learning, artificial intelligence, and predictive analytics. โข Energy Flow Optimization Algorithms and Protocols: This unit will delve into the different optimization algorithms and protocols used in IoT for energy flow optimization. โข Cybersecurity for IoT-based Energy Management Systems: This unit will focus on the cybersecurity threats faced by IoT-based energy management systems and the best practices to mitigate these risks. โข Wireless Communication Protocols for IoT Energy Management Systems: This unit will cover the various wireless communication protocols used in IoT energy management systems, including Zigbee, Z-Wave, Bluetooth, and Wi-Fi. โข Advanced Energy Storage Solutions: This unit will cover the latest energy storage solutions and their integration into IoT-based energy management systems. โข Smart Grids and IoT: This unit will focus on the role of IoT in smart grids, including grid automation, demand-side management, and energy trading. โข Renewable Energy Integration with IoT: This unit will cover the integration of renewable energy sources like solar, wind, and hydro into IoT-based energy management systems. โข Case Studies on IoT-based Energy Flow Optimization: This unit will present real-world case studies on the implementation of IoT-based energy flow optimization systems.
